Discovery Green
Park · Houston, Texas
A 12-acre park at 1500 McKinney Street, open daily from 6am to 11pm and run by the Discovery Green Conservancy, a 501(c)(3) nonprofit, which states that more than 600 free events are held there every year.
History
The park opened on April 13, 2008. The City of Houston acquired part of the land in 2002 and purchased the remainder in 2004. Design was led by Hargreaves Associates, and the $125 million project drew philanthropic funding including $10 million from the Kinder Foundation. It earned LEED Gold certification in October 2009.
